About Angela Hammoud
Angela Hammoud joined McKeen & Associates in 2026 after working as a trial attorney at another medical malpractice and personal injury law firm. She focuses on complex civil litigation, with experience handling medical malpractice, wrongful death, premises liability, and employment-related claims. She is known for strategic case development and thorough preparation at every stage of litigation, and has worked closely with nationally recognized experts across multiple disciplines on high-stakes, medically complex matters. She graduated from Thomas M. Cooley Law School with a Juris Doctorate and earned her B.S. in Psychology from Wayne State University.
